The JBL Charge 4 is a waterproof, Bluetooth capable speaker that additionally functions as a portable charger for smartphones. It is identifiable by its model number: CHARGE4S.

Cannot connect JBL charge 4 to JBL charge 3 in stereo mode.

When using the JBL connect app, the app will not allow me to connect my JBL charge 3 to my charge 4 in stereo mode; it instantly defaults back to party mode every time I try. Has anyone else had this issue? Both firmware’s are up to date on each device and the JBL connect app is up to date aswell.
